Jump to content

Plus DECT перестал подключаться на прошивке 3.7.1


Recommended Posts

Всем привет! Недавно обновил прошивку роутера Keenetic Ultra 1810 до версии 3.7.1 и, после обновления, Plus DECT перестал подключаться к VoIP серверу. В статусе линии пишет «Error (408 Request Timeout)».

Я захватил сетевой дамп по протоколу sip и увидел только два этапа из четырёх – 1) запрос “REGISTER” и 2) ответ “401 Unauthorized” с предложением авторизоваться по MD5. Больше Keenetic ничего не отвечает и через 12 секунд начинает заново с 1 этапа. Может быть VoIP сервер и клиент не могут согласовать параметры авторизации и передачи данных? При этом другой Keenetic Ultra II со старой прошивкой и ровно теми-же настройками успешно подключается. Да и новый 1810 до обновления прошивки успешно подключался.

 

 

Пожалуйста, помогите мне найти мою проблему и решить её.

Заранее спасибо за помощь.

 

 

Сетевой дамп:

Запрос от клиента к серверу

 

Session Initiation Protocol (REGISTER)

    Request-Line: REGISTER sip:sip.test.com SIP/2.0

        Method: REGISTER

       Request-URI: sip:sip.test.com

        [Resent Packet: False]

    Message Header

        Via: SIP/2.0/UDP 192.168.3.3:5060;rport;branch=z9hG4bKPjMwHUTEBUPKzmaknY5LvIq0QhTm1DA5HG

            Transport: UDP

            Sent-by Address: 192.168.3.3

            Sent-by port: 5060

            RPort: rport

            Branch: z9hG4bKPjMwHUTEBUPKzmaknY5LvIq0QhTm1DA5HG

        Max-Forwards: 70

        From: "User" <sip:1000@sip.test.com>;tag=FXiq2PwjGuZEmkgMCnLYC7BHAqh-Sxxp

            SIP Display info: "User"

            SIP from address: sip:1000@sip.test.com

                SIP from address User Part: 1000

                SIP from address Host Part: sip.test.com

            SIP from tag: FXiq2PwjGuZEmkgMCnLYC7BHAqh-Sxxp

        To: "User" <sip:1000@sip.test.com>

            SIP Display info: "User"

            SIP to address: sip:1000@sip.test.com

                SIP to address User Part: 1000

                SIP to address Host Part: sip.test.com

        Call-ID: zeCy1o2QtsQ6jKFYwed1M.9M.zZmjNUy

        CSeq: 64758 REGISTER

            Sequence Number: 64758

            Method: REGISTER

        User-Agent: Keenetic Plus DECT

        Contact: "User" <sip:1000@192.168.3.3:5060;ob>

            SIP Display info: "User"

            Contact URI: sip:1000@192.168.3.3:5060;ob

        Expires: 180

        Allow: PRACK, INVITE, ACK, BYE, CANCEL, UPDATE, INFO, SUBSCRIBE, NOTIFY, REFER, MESSAGE, OPTIONS

        Content-Length:  0

 

 

Ответ от сервера к клиенту

 

Session Initiation Protocol (401)

    Status-Line: SIP/2.0 401 Unauthorized

        Status-Code: 401

        [Resent Packet: False]

        [Request Frame: 1]

        [Response Time (ms): 46]

    Message Header

        Via: SIP/2.0/UDP 192.168.3.3:5060;rport=5060;received=10.10.10.1;branch=z9hG4bKPjMwHUTEBUPKzmaknY5LvIq0QhTm1DA5HG

            Transport: UDP

            Sent-by Address: 192.168.3.3

            Sent-by port: 5060

            RPort: 5060

            Received: 10.10.10.1

            Branch: z9hG4bKPjMwHUTEBUPKzmaknY5LvIq0QhTm1DA5HG

        Call-ID: zeCy1o2QtsQ6jKFYwed1M.9M.zZmjNUy

        From: "User" <sip:1000@sip.test.com>;tag=FXiq2PwjGuZEmkgMCnLYC7BHAqh-Sxxp

            SIP Display info: "User"

            SIP from address: sip:1000@sip.test.com

                SIP from address User Part: 1000

                SIP from address Host Part: sip.test.com

            SIP from tag: FXiq2PwjGuZEmkgMCnLYC7BHAqh-Sxxp

        To: "User" <sip:1000@sip.test.com>;tag=z9hG4bKPjMwHUTEBUPKzmaknY5LvIq0QhTm1DA5HG

            SIP Display info: "User"

            SIP to address: sip:1000@sip.test.com

                SIP to address User Part: 1000

                SIP to address Host Part: sip.test.com

            SIP to tag: z9hG4bKPjMwHUTEBUPKzmaknY5LvIq0QhTm1DA5HG

        CSeq: 64758 REGISTER

            Sequence Number: 64758

            Method: REGISTER

        WWW-Authenticate: Digest  realm="asterisk",nonce="1642454567/01420ca800512aac4b55c677b4504ba1",opaque="2b1e268a75a542cb",algorithm=md5,qop="auth"

            Authentication Scheme: Digest

            Realm: "asterisk"

            Nonce Value: "1642454567/01420ca800512aac4b55c677b4504ba1"

            Opaque Value: "2b1e268a75a542cb"

            Algorithm: md5

            QOP: "auth"

        Server: FPBX-12.0.76.6(13.14.0)

        Content-Length:  0

 

Edited by Max34
Link to comment
Share on other sites

  • Max34 changed the title to Plus DECT перестал подключаться на прошивке 3.7.1

На странице настройки телефонной линии в поле “Прокси-сервер SIP” добавьте порт 5060 справа от доменного имени через двоеточие. Это должно решить проблему с SIP-регистрацией. Отсутствие регистрации вызвано ошибкой в реализации функции DNS SRV resolving, которую добавили в 3.7.1. Разработчики занимаются исправлением DNS SRV resolving и скоро проблема будет решена.

  • Thanks 2
Link to comment
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.
Note: Your post will require moderator approval before it will be visible.

Guest
Reply to this topic...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• Recently Browsing   0 members

    • No registered users viewing this page.
×
×
  • Create New...